Ставь лайки и следи за новостями
Модуль торговых сигналов на основе индикатора "Delta ZigZag".
Библиотека FuzzyNet для создания нечетких моделей была написана на C#. При переводе на MQL5 в библиотеку добавлены 8 функций принадлежности и 4 метода дефаззификации для систем типа Мамдани.
Подсмотренные из разных мест оригинальные математические функции, которые либо не имеют аналогов, либо выполняют свою работу значительно быстрее, чем альтернативные реализации
Хотелось бы думать над алгоритмами и методами, а не над синтаксическими особенностями размещения ордеров. Здесь приведены простые функции по работе с позициями в MQL5.
Библиотека для работы с файлами средствами WinAPI без ограничений по месту нахождения.
Класс CADXWOnArray предназначен для расчета значений индикатора ADXW (Average Directional Movement Index Wilder, ADX Wilder) по индикаторным буферам.
Класс CMACDOnArray предназначен для расчета значений индикатора MACD (Moving Average Convergence/Divergence, MACD) по индикаторному буферу.
Класс CDeMarkerOnArray предназначен для расчета значений индикатора DeMarker по индикаторным буферам.
Этот неторгующий советник генерирует информацию по пользовательскому символу на минутном графике.
Нечеткая логика - современная наука, которая активно используется в военном деле, в частности, для наведения ракет. Теперь она доступна трейдерам.
Класс CMAOnArray предназначен для расчета средних (Moving Average) по индикаторному буферу.
Класс предназначен для создания интерактивных кнопок на графике цены с различными состояниями.
Эта библиотека даёт возможность работать с COM-объектами, предоставленными некоторыми приложениями. Например: Excel, Word, Mathcad, Matlab. А также объект ADODB для работы с базами данных через драйвер ODBC. Библиотека работает и в MT4 и в MT5.
Класс CDebugLogger - это гибкая и всеобъемлющая утилита для ведения журнала, предназначенная для использования в средах MQL4/5. Он позволяет разработчикам регистрировать сообщения различных уровней важности (INFO, WARNING, ERROR, DEBUG) с возможностью включения в записи журнала временных меток, сигнатур функций, имен файлов и номеров строк. Класс поддерживает запись логов как в консоль, так и в файлы, с возможностью сохранения логов в общей папке и в формате CSV. Кроме того, он предлагает функциональность для глушения журналов на основе определенных ключевых слов, что гарантирует, что конфиденциальная информация не будет записана в журнал. Этот класс идеально подходит для разработчиков, желающих внедрить надежные механизмы протоколирования в свои MQL4/5-приложения, с настраиваемыми функциями, удовлетворяющими широкий спектр потребностей в отладке и мониторинге.
Класс CStdDevOnArray предназначен для расчета стандартного отклонения (Standard Deviation, StdDev) по индикаторному буферу.
Класс CTemaOnArray предназначен для расчета значений индикатора TEMA (Triple Exponential Moving Average, TEMA) по индикаторному буферу.
Модуль торговых сигналов для Мастера MQL5. Сигналом для открытия позиций служит появление цветной точки индикатора SilverTrend_Signal.
Класс CADOnArray предназначен для расчета индикатора AD (Accumulation Distribution, A/D) по индикаторным буферам. В качестве примера использования класса прилагается индикатор Test_ADOnArray.
Модуль торговых сигналов для Мастера MQL5. Сигналом для открытия позиций служит появление цветной стрелки индикатора Go.
Модуль торговых сигналов для Мастера MQL5. Сигналом для открытия позиций служит появление цветной стрелки индикатора Sidus.
Функция расшифровки кода результата торговой операции для функций OrderSend() и OrderCheck().
Библиотека рассчитывает оптимальное F на основе среднего геометрического. Ральф Винс писал: "В реальной торговле размер проигрышей и выигрышей будут постоянно меняться. Поэтому формулы Келли не могут дать нам правильное оптимальное f". Я создал эту библиотеку для расчета оптимального f на основе среднего геометрического, используя формулы Винса.
Класс CStochasticOnArray предназначен для расчета значений индикатора Stochastic по индикаторным буферам.
Модуль торговых сигналов для Мастера MQL5. Сигналом для открытия позиций служит появление цветной точки индикатора ASCtrendSignal.
Модуль торговых сигналов для Мастера MQL5. Сигналом для открытия позиций служит появление цветной стрелки индикатора Stalin.
Библиотека функций для работы с таймсериями: iBars, iTime, iOpen, iHigh, iLow, iClose, iVolume, iHighest, iLowest, iBarshift. Для всех функций доступен краткий вариант вызова (с символом и периодом текущего графика).
Используется идея классического сглаживания MA. Класс можно использовать в случае, когда необходимо сгладить любой массив типа double, не используя стандартный индикатор.